Job Description

The International Cricket Council (ICC) is the global governing body for the sport, which administers all aspects of international cricket.

We are looking for a Development Officer - Asia to be based at our headquarters in Dubai, UAE. The role will report to the Development Manager - Asia. This role is responsible for the implementation of the ICC's Development Programs in the Asia region and provide support in all relevant global projects related to cricket development.

Principal Accountabilities

Responsibilities of the Development Officer - Asia include but are not limited to the following:

Governanced and Administration Provide support to ICC Members across Asia;

  • Build and maintain cordial and productive working relationships with ICC Asia Members (Members), National Olympic Committees, relevant government authorities within the Membership and such similar organisations.
  • Assist Members in formulating and implementing strategic plans, annual operational plans and budgets.
  • Assist the Regional Development Manager Asia and other staff with monitoring budget utilization in Member countries.
  • Ensure accurate data collection from Members as part of the annual census process or as required from time to time.
  • Implement and assist Members with adoption of any technology solution deployed by ICC like Learning Management System, Data Collection Tools, etc.
  • Provide effective and timely service to Members on all relevant products and services offered by the ICC.

Training and Education Program

  • Assist the Member in delivering ICC Training and Education programs.
  • Assisting in the development and implementation of national plans for cricket education for coaches, pitch curators, and umpires in Member countries, with the goal of fostering self-sufficiency.
  • Identifying and lead a team of tutors/assessor's workforce in the region; communicating regularly with them and providing them with continual professional development opportunities.
  • Sharing best practices, initiatives and resources with the Members around Training and Education initiatives.
  • Assist the Member in building capacity (with a focus towards the growth of women's cricket) with respect to delivery of cricket within their countries by increasing the quantity and continuously improving the quality of coaches, umpires, curators etc.
  • Colloborate with global counterparts and Head Office resources in assisting and co-developing relevant Training and Education products and services offered by ICC.

Growing Participation

  • Assisting Members in planning and delivery of effective and sustainable participation programs.
  • Develop, implement and monitor girls and women specific participation programs.
  • Assisting Members in developing their cricket structures.
  • Sharing best practices, initiatives and resources with Members around mass participation initiatives.
  • Collaborating with global counterparts and Head Office resources in assisting and co-developing relevant Participation products and services offered by ICC.

High Performance

  • If and when required, deliver specialist on field coaching programmes and sessions.
  • Implement the ICC High Performance framework for all Members with a focus towards women's cricket.
  • Assist Members participating in various ICC events with a view of increasing the competitiveness of the event.

Events / Tournament operations

  • To support the planning and delivery of ICC pathway events as appropriate.
